Найдено 55 результатов

vano.mig
2019.08.05, 23:55
Форум: Общие вопросы (Yii 2.x)
Тема: выборка по дате у четом таймзоны
Ответы: 0
Просмотры: 150

выборка по дате у четом таймзоны

Привет. Столкнулся с проблемой. Нужно сделать выборку отчетов из базы по дате с учетом тайм зоны юзеров. $query = UserProgramReportLevelSearch::find()->alias('t'); $query->joinWith(['userProgram', 'profile', 'user']); $dataProvider = new ActiveDataProvider(['query' => $query]); $this->load($params);...
vano.mig
2019.04.29, 22:32
Форум: Общие вопросы (Yii 2.x)
Тема: Авторизация
Ответы: 1
Просмотры: 195

Авторизация

Ребята привет. Столкнулся с проблемой - после ввода логина и пароля не происходит авторизации, то есть после выполнения метода login() Yii::$app->user->identity = true, Но после перезагрузки страниці все слетает... модель <?php namespace app\models; use Yii; use yii\base\Model; /** * LoginForm is th...
vano.mig
2019.04.18, 12:34
Форум: Общие вопросы (Yii 1.x)
Тема: Подключить екстеншн с неймспейсами
Ответы: 6
Просмотры: 358

Re: Подключить екстеншн с неймспейсами

приходится костыль делать.
Понял, спасибо.
Подскажите куда этот if вставить (в init(), создать сласс компонент...)
vano.mig
2019.04.18, 10:25
Форум: Общие вопросы (Yii 1.x)
Тема: Подключить екстеншн с неймспейсами
Ответы: 6
Просмотры: 358

Re: Подключить екстеншн с неймспейсами

хороший вариант, но в этом проекте не используется композер и инсталить его не можно.
Как быть в данной ситуации?
vano.mig
2019.04.17, 17:12
Форум: Общие вопросы (Yii 1.x)
Тема: Подключить екстеншн с неймспейсами
Ответы: 6
Просмотры: 358

Подключить екстеншн с неймспейсами

Привет, ребята. Делаю проект на первом Yii, столкнулся с проблемой. Нужно сделать выгрузку в xls, для этоговзял вот библиотеку https://github.com/PHPOffice/PhpSpreadsheet столкнулся с проблемой - как ее подключить, она использует неймспейсы. Пытался их отпарсить public static function autoload($clas...
vano.mig
2019.01.10, 16:39
Форум: Общие вопросы (Yii 2.x)
Тема: ajax некоректно работает
Ответы: 6
Просмотры: 448

Re: ajax некоректно работает

спасибо, все работает!))
можно вопрос: это были изменения в структуре фреймворка или php? просто раньше через echo работали запросы
Спасибо огромное за помощь)
vano.mig
2019.01.10, 16:28
Форум: Общие вопросы (Yii 2.x)
Тема: ajax некоректно работает
Ответы: 6
Просмотры: 448

ajax некоректно работает

Всем привет. Помогите найти ошибку. Пытаюсь передать форму аяксом и сохранить ее в базу. После сохранение данных в базе получаю статус ок и ошибку yii\web\HeadersAlreadySentException: Headers already sent in frontend/controllers/SiteController.php on line 270 вот контроллер, нужен action Support <?p...
vano.mig
2018.06.26, 17:17
Форум: Общие вопросы (Yii 1.x)
Тема: вложенный модуль
Ответы: 1
Просмотры: 533

вложенный модуль

Всем привыет. Так получилось что мне по работе нужно перейти на Yii1 и доработать проект.. В Yii я не очень силен. Мне нужно создать вложенный модуль. У меня в папке "modules" есть модуль 'connector'. В нем я создал директорию 'modules' и закинул модуль shipping' Как настроить конфиги, чтоб модуль s...
vano.mig
2018.06.12, 10:07
Форум: Общие вопросы (Yii 2.x)
Тема: GridVeiw filer search
Ответы: 4
Просмотры: 391

Re: GridVeiw filer search

все, спасибо, разобрался.
сделал так

Код: Выделить всё

$query = Offer::find()->joinWith(['category', 'country'])->orderBy(['id'=>SORT_DESC]);

Код: Выделить всё

 'offer_to_category.category_id' => $this->category_id,
 'offer_to_country.country_id' => $this->country,
vano.mig
2018.06.11, 17:38
Форум: Общие вопросы (Yii 2.x)
Тема: GridVeiw filer search
Ответы: 4
Просмотры: 391

Re: GridVeiw filer search

я не знаю где точно ошибка...
но склоняюсь к тому что она в модели OfferSearch вот здесь

Код: Выделить всё

$query = Offer::find()->with('category')->orderBy(['id'=>SORT_DESC]);
или

Код: Выделить всё

'category_id' => $this->id,
vano.mig
2018.06.11, 17:18
Форум: Общие вопросы (Yii 2.x)
Тема: GridVeiw filer search
Ответы: 4
Просмотры: 391

GridVeiw filer search

Здравствуйте!, Помогите решить проблему с фильтром в GridView для поля из связной таблицы со связью hasMany Model <?php namespace common\models; use yii\behaviors\TimestampBehavior; use common\components\behaviors\HistoryBehavior; use yii\db\ActiveRecord; use common\components\Date; use common\model...
vano.mig
2018.03.26, 13:55
Форум: Общие вопросы (Yii 2.x)
Тема: Формирование URL
Ответы: 1
Просмотры: 258

Формирование URL

Привет всем! Прошу помощи в добавлении параметра и URL заказчику нужно было сделать мультиязычный сайт, но параметры (ru, en) в url чтоб не выводились. Я сделал, все норм. И вот теперь ему захотелось видеть этот параметр в адресной строке. Чтобы не переписывать код хочу просто добавить этот параметр...
vano.mig
2018.03.02, 14:13
Форум: Общие вопросы (Yii 2.x)
Тема: ошибка ActiveDataProvider
Ответы: 3
Просмотры: 401

Re: ошибка ActiveDataProvider

На yii первом я фильтрацию делал так

Код: Выделить всё

$model = new Order;
$order = new CActiveDataProvider('order');
$order->criteria->compare($res, $value, true);
Вот перешел на yii2 пытаюсь применить...
vano.mig
2018.03.02, 13:52
Форум: Общие вопросы (Yii 2.x)
Тема: ошибка ActiveDataProvider
Ответы: 3
Просмотры: 401

ошибка ActiveDataProvider

Всем привет. нужно сделать фильтр операций пользователя (по платежной системе, статусу и типу операции). Дабы не писать кучу кода хотел воспользоваться DataProvider->criteria->compare(); Но вылезла ошибка, чувствую что мелочь...найти не могу...Подскажите плз модель <?php namespace app\models; use Yi...
vano.mig
2018.02.28, 18:53
Форум: Общие вопросы (Yii 2.x)
Тема: как отправить письмо с изображением на почту
Ответы: 6
Просмотры: 782

Re: как отправить письмо с изображением на почту

все равно не получается, выдает ошибку Method Swift_Image::__toString() must not throw an exception, caught Swift_IoException: Unable to open file for reading вот как загружаю фото <img src="<?= $message->embed(Swift_Image::fromPath('/web/images/email/btn-link.png')); ?>" alt="btn-link"> функция отп...
vano.mig
2018.02.28, 15:00
Форум: Общие вопросы (Yii 2.x)
Тема: как отправить письмо с изображением на почту
Ответы: 6
Просмотры: 782

как отправить письмо с изображением на почту

Привет. Для отправки писем использую SwiftMailer, протокол Smtp(gnail.com). Возникла проблема - нужно при отправке почты в тело html вставить логотип(фото). Без изображения у меня код работает, но если добавляю фото - оно не отображается. Подскажите что делать. код страницы для отправки на почту <?p...
vano.mig
2017.12.13, 18:57
Форум: Общие вопросы (Yii 1.x)
Тема: настройки rewrite rules
Ответы: 4
Просмотры: 825

Re: настройки rewrite rules

вопрос снят. Так у меня ничего и не получилось. Сделал стандартно, тоесть, папку framework переместил на один уровень выше, а в .htaccess стандартные настройки AddDefaultCharset utf8 RewriteEngine on # if a directory or a file exists, use it directly R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%...
vano.mig
2017.12.13, 11:06
Форум: Общие вопросы (Yii 1.x)
Тема: настройки rewrite rules
Ответы: 4
Просмотры: 825

Re: настройки rewrite rules

сделат так. файл в корне .htaccess Options +FollowSymLinks IndexIgnore */* RewriteEngine on #RewriteCond %{SERVER_PORT} !^443$ # RewriteRule ^(.*)$ http://cms.zmogesh.com/$1 [R=301,L] RewriteCond %{REQUEST_URI} !^/(html) #RewriteRule ^assets/(.*)$ /html/assets/$1 [L] #RewriteRule ^css/(.*)$ /html/cs...